Output 128e82bc4eb852851fe5ad336b406960ad42e435476cc0684f37c2d3be8b2873:0

value
10500100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c14e44ab9574a404c9892c35f881766c50338d OP_EQUAL
address
3DRozDUt5u7vSYZAu5Apjg55TyD1wU6jeF
transaction
128e82bc4eb852851fe5ad336b406960ad42e435476cc0684f37c2d3be8b2873
confirmations
248333
spent
true